CBR F3 hesitation/ need jetting?? need help
ok so i have a 95 f3 i have a hesitation around 130mph and around 8-9k. i run ngk plat spark plug. stock air filter. and muffler is modded iv gutted it out and left one baffle in it. before i gutted it it would hit a;ll of 168 no problem at all for her. now that iv gutted it. it has a damn hesitation. it the muffler flowing to much for stock jets ext. will i need to re jet it and if so do i have to have it re sync again!! plz help
Exhaust mod usually calls for a stage 1 jet kit, it's probably running lean in the top end because of the all the extra airflow. I would assume you'd want to resync after rejetting, just to make sure it's pulling like it should.
